Why Braided Sleeves Are Gaining Traction

Braided sleeve reinforcement materials are engineered fabrics that provide structural support, protection, and durability to various components. Their unique braided construction offers superior flexibility, impact resistance, and thermal stability compared to traditional materials. These properties make them ideal for demanding applications in aerospace and automotive manufacturing.

In the EV sector, braided sleeves are used to protect high-voltage cables, battery lines, and other critical electrical systems. They help manage heat dissipation and shield against abrasion, ensuring safety and reliability. Meanwhile, aerospace manufacturers utilize these materials in fuel lines, hydraulic systems, and structural reinforcements, where weight reduction and performance are paramount.

Key Demand Drivers in EV and Aerospace

The growth of the braided sleeve market is closely tied to broader trends in transportation and energy. Let's break down the main forces propelling this market:

  • EV Adoption: As global EV sales climb, the need for robust cable management and protection systems grows exponentially.
  • Aerospace Innovation: New aircraft designs increasingly rely on composite materials and advanced textiles to improve fuel efficiency and reduce emissions.
  • Regulatory Pressure: Stricter safety and environmental regulations are pushing manufacturers to adopt higher-performance materials.
  • Lightweighting: Both industries are aggressively pursuing weight reduction to extend range (EVs) and cut fuel costs (aerospace).
